Output 593233260c6dc5a4b0bbfca9974f418683d0213e5fe8a51c4829fddc73a229f8:10

value
13752880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e4f57f534f9d6146fbc2d803ae443e032684705 OP_EQUALVERIFY OP_CHECKSIG
address
16gTwnP8bpiPRn3fgBzixpeaxJ9sUGaZq9
transaction
593233260c6dc5a4b0bbfca9974f418683d0213e5fe8a51c4829fddc73a229f8
spent
true